Système d’exploitation GCSE : tout savoir et fonctionnement expliqué

Les systèmes d’exploitation jouent un rôle fondamental dans la gestion et l’exécution des tâches sur nos ordinateurs et autres appareils numériques. Le GCSE, ou General Certificate of Secondary Education, se trouve souvent au centre des discussions techniques en raison de son importance dans l’éducation informatique. Comprendre son fonctionnement et ses caractéristiques est essentiel pour quiconque souhaite maîtriser les bases de l’informatique.
En plongeant dans les détails du système d’exploitation GCSE, on découvre comment il gère les ressources matérielles et logicielles, assure la sécurité des données et facilite l’interaction utilisateur-machine. Cette exploration permet de saisir les mécanismes qui rendent nos appareils intelligents et efficaces.
A lire en complément : Quels sont les avantages du troisième pilier ?
Plan de l'article
Qu’est-ce qu’un système d’exploitation GCSE ?
Le système d’exploitation GCSE, acronyme de General Certificate of Secondary Education, représente bien plus qu’un simple programme informatique. Il s’agit d’une plateforme centrale qui permet la gestion et l’exécution des diverses applications et processus sur un ordinateur. Cette interface assure une liaison efficiente entre le matériel et le logiciel, garantissant ainsi une utilisation optimale des ressources de l’appareil.
Fonctions clés
- Gestion des ressources : Le système d’exploitation GCSE supervise l’utilisation des ressources matérielles telles que le processeur, la mémoire vive et les périphériques. Cette gestion permet une allocation efficiente de ces ressources aux différentes applications en cours d’exécution.
- Sécurité : La protection des données et des informations personnelles est un aspect central du GCSE. Il inclut des mécanismes de sécurité robustes pour empêcher les accès non autorisés et protéger contre les malwares.
- Interface utilisateur : Le GCSE offre une interface utilisateur conviviale, permettant aux utilisateurs d’interagir facilement avec le système. Cette interface peut être graphique (GUI) ou en ligne de commande (CLI), selon les besoins spécifiques.
- Gestion des fichiers : L’organisation, le stockage et la gestion des données sur les disques durs et autres supports de stockage sont pris en charge par le GCSE. Cela inclut la création, la modification et la suppression de fichiers et dossiers.
Composants principaux
Composant | Description |
---|---|
Kernel | Le noyau constitue le cœur du système, gérant les opérations de base et l’interaction entre le matériel et le logiciel. |
Shell | Le shell est l’interface qui permet aux utilisateurs de communiquer avec le système d’exploitation via des commandes. |
System Utilities | Ces utilitaires offrent des outils et des programmes supplémentaires pour la maintenance et la gestion du système. |
Fonctions principales d’un système d’exploitation GCSE
Gestion des processus
Le système d’exploitation GCSE dispose d’une capacité à gérer simultanément plusieurs processus. Chaque application en cours d’exécution correspond à un ou plusieurs processus. La gestion de ces processus inclut :
A découvrir également : Choisir une formation professionnelle : les erreurs à éviter pour réussir
- Planification : Attribution du temps du processeur aux différents processus.
- Synchronisation : Coordination entre processus pour éviter les conflits.
- Communication : Échange d’informations entre processus via des mécanismes comme les pipes ou les files d’attente.
Gestion de la mémoire
Le GCSE optimise l’utilisation de la mémoire vive (RAM). Les différentes techniques employées incluent :
- Allocation : Répartition de la mémoire aux processus en cours.
- Pagination : Division de la mémoire en pages pour une gestion flexible.
- Segmentation : Organisation de la mémoire en segments logiques.
Gestion des périphériques
Le GCSE intègre des pilotes permettant la communication avec divers périphériques (imprimantes, disques durs, etc.). Les responsabilités englobent :
- Contrôle des entrées/sorties : Gestion des opérations de lecture et d’écriture.
- Allocation des périphériques : Attribution des périphériques aux processus nécessitant leur utilisation.
Gestion des fichiers
Le GCSE organise et maintient les fichiers sur les supports de stockage. Les fonctions incluent :
- Création et suppression : Gestion des fichiers et répertoires.
- Lecture et écriture : Accès aux données stockées.
- Protection : Définition des droits d’accès pour garantir la sécurité des informations.
Exemples de systèmes d’exploitation GCSE courants
Windows
Windows, développé par Microsoft, est l’un des systèmes d’exploitation les plus utilisés dans le monde. Connu pour sa compatibilité étendue avec une large gamme de logiciels et périphériques, il est couramment utilisé dans les environnements professionnels et personnels. Windows offre une interface utilisateur graphique conviviale et des fonctionnalités telles que :
- Gestion avancée des fichiers : Utilisation de l’Explorateur de fichiers pour organiser les données.
- Multitâche : Exécution simultanée de plusieurs applications.
Linux
Linux, un système d’exploitation open source, est apprécié pour sa stabilité et sa sécurité. Utilisé principalement par des développeurs et dans les infrastructures de serveurs, il dispose de distributions variées telles que Ubuntu, Fedora et Debian. Les caractéristiques notables de Linux incluent :
- Personnalisation : Possibilité de modifier et d’adapter le système en fonction des besoins spécifiques.
- Communauté active : Support et développement continus par une communauté mondiale de contributeurs.
macOS
macOS, le système d’exploitation d’Apple pour les ordinateurs Mac, est reconnu pour son interface élégante et son intégration transparente avec d’autres produits Apple. Destiné principalement aux créatifs et aux professionnels, macOS propose des fonctionnalités comme :
- Environnement de développement : Outils performants pour les développeurs, notamment Xcode.
- Écosystème Apple : Synchronisation fluide avec les appareils iPhone, iPad et Apple Watch.
Importance des systèmes d’exploitation GCSE pour les étudiants
Les systèmes d’exploitation GCSE jouent un rôle fondamental dans la formation des étudiants en informatique. La maîtrise de ces systèmes permet de développer des compétences techniques essentielles et d’acquérir une compréhension approfondie des concepts informatiques fondamentaux.
Développement des compétences techniques
Les étudiants apprennent à naviguer et à utiliser divers systèmes d’exploitation, ce qui leur permet de devenir polyvalents et de s’adapter à différents environnements technologiques. Parmi les compétences acquises :
- Installation et configuration : Mise en place de systèmes d’exploitation sur différents types de matériel.
- Gestion des ressources : Optimisation de l’utilisation de la mémoire, du processeur et du stockage.
- Résolution de problèmes : Identification et correction des dysfonctionnements système.
Compréhension des concepts fondamentaux
Les systèmes d’exploitation GCSE fournissent un cadre pour l’étude des concepts informatiques de base. Les étudiants explorent des sujets tels que la gestion des processus, la gestion de la mémoire et la sécurité informatique. Cette connaissance théorique est appliquée à des situations pratiques, renforçant ainsi leur compréhension.
Préparation à la carrière
La familiarité avec plusieurs systèmes d’exploitation augmente l’employabilité des étudiants. Les compétences acquises sont recherchées dans divers secteurs, notamment :
- Développement logiciel : Conception et création de logiciels compatibles avec différents systèmes d’exploitation.
- Administration réseau : Gestion et maintenance des infrastructures réseaux.
- Support technique : Assistance aux utilisateurs finaux dans la résolution de problèmes informatiques.
Les systèmes d’exploitation GCSE, en fournissant à la fois une formation technique et théorique, préparent les étudiants à relever les défis technologiques contemporains.